Ingredients
– 1 cup semi-sweet chocolate chips
– ½ cup unsalted butter
– 2 large eggs
– 2 large egg yolks
– ¼ cup granulated sugar
– 2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
– ½ teaspoon vanilla extract
– A pinch of salt
– Optional: powdered sugar for dusting
– Optional: vanilla ice cream for serving
Instructions
Creating this Lava Cake Recipe is as easy as following these simple steps:
1. Preheat the Oven: Preheat your oven to 425°F (220°C). Grease four ramekins with butter and lightly dust with cocoa powder.
2. Melt Chocolate and Butter: In a microwave-safe bowl, combine the chocolate chips and butter. Microwave in 30-second intervals, stirring in between, until melted and smooth.
3. Whisk Eggs and Sugar: In a separate bowl, whisk together the eggs, egg yolks, and granulated sugar until well combined and slightly thickened.
4. Combine Mixtures: Pour the melted chocolate mixture into the egg mixture. Stir until fully combined.
5. Add Flour and Vanilla: Gently fold in the flour, vanilla extract, and a pinch of salt until just combined. Be careful not to overmix.
6. Fill Ramekins: Divide the batter evenly among the prepared ramekins, filling each about ¾ full.
7. Bake: Place the ramekins on a baking sheet and bake in the preheated oven for 12-15 minutes, or until the edges are firm but the center remains soft.
8. Cool Slightly: Remove from the oven and let them cool for about 5 minutes. This will help the cakes hold their shape when unmolding.
9. Unmold Carefully: Run a knife around the edges of each ramekin to loosen the cake. Invert onto a plate and gently lift off the ramekin.
10. Dust with Powdered Sugar: If desired, dust the top with powdered sugar for an elegant finishing touch.

-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 12-15 minutes
